Mr. Dachshund is Canadian, and like a few of the Bees in the recent past, he and I are going through the seemingly endless immigration process. Long distance relationships are always difficult, as I’m sure many of you can sympathize. But! There is a fast-approaching light at the end of our tunnel; I can finally say, with certainty, that Mr. D will be here soon!

Due to the rules of our specific visa, Mr. D and I must be married within 90 days of his arrival to the US. With his estimated arrival date of October 20, our May 2010 wedding is far from the allotted three-month time line! So, we’ve decided that we’ll “make it legal” first.
